* Please note that this function is for convenience, but should not
|
||||||
|
* be used to resample audio in blocks, as it will introduce audio
|
||||||
|
* artifacts on the boundaries. You should only use this function if
|
||||||
|
* you are converting audio data in its entirety in one call. If you
|
||||||
|
* want to convert audio in smaller chunks, use an SDL_AudioStream,
|
||||||
|
* which is designed for this situation.
|
||||||
|
*
|
||||||
|
* Internally, this function creates and destroys an SDL_AudioStream
|
||||||
|
* on each use, so it's also less efficient than using one directly,
|
||||||
|
* if you need to convert multiple times.
